Managing Pain and Adverse Effects



To take care of pain and adverse effects following your LASIK surgical treatment, it's necessary to know typical signs and symptoms that may arise. It's normal to experience some dryness, itching, or mild pain in the initial few days post-surgery. Your eyes might additionally be sensitive to light or feel like there's something in them. To ease these symptoms, your ophthalmologist may advise using lubricating eye decreases and using safety sunglasses when outdoors.




Some clients might additionally discover temporary changes in vision, such as glow, halos, or difficulty with night vision. These concerns typically boost as your eyes recover.
